云服务器上怎么部署网站

云服务器上怎么部署网站,随着互联网的普及,越来越多的企业和个人开始使用云服务器来部署自己的网站,云服务器具有弹性扩展、安全稳定、成本低廉等优点,因此成为越来越多人的选择,本文将详细介绍如何在云服务器上部署网站,帮助大家顺利完成网站的搭建工作。,
,1、购买云服务器:首先需要购买一台云服务器,可以选择阿里云、腾讯云、华为云等国内知名云服务商,根据自己的需求选择合适的配置,如CPU、内存、硬盘等。,2、注册域名:购买云服务器后,需要为自己的网站购买一个域名,以便于用户访问,可以在国内知名的域名注册商如阿里云、腾讯云等进行注册。,3、备案:根据中国大陆的相关法规,网站需要进行备案,在购买云服务器时,可以选择已备案的服务器,这样可以省去备案的过程,如果没有备案,可以选择香港或国外的服务器进行搭建。,在云服务器上部署网站,首先要安装Web服务器软件,常见的Web服务器软件有Apache、nginx、IIS等,以Nginx为例,可以通过SSH工具连接到云服务器,然后执行以下命令进行安装:,安装完成后,需要对Nginx进行配置,创建一个新的站点配置文件:,
,将以下内容粘贴到配置文件中,注意修改
mywebsite为你自己的域名,以及
/var/www/html为你网站的存放路径:,保存并退出编辑器,接下来,创建一个符号链接,将配置文件链接到
sites-enabled目录:,检查Nginx配置文件的语法是否正确:,如果一切正常,重启Nginx服务:,至此,Nginx已经配置完成,可以开始部署网站了,将本地的网站文件上传到云服务器的指定路径即可,可以使用FTP工具(如FileZilla)或者SCP命令进行上传,使用SCP命令上传本地的
mywebsite.com文件夹到云服务器的
/var/www/html目录下:,
,1、优化网站性能:为了提高网站的访问速度,可以使用
CDN(内容分发网络)进行加速,还可以通过压缩图片、合并CSS和JavaScript文件等方式进行优化。,2、加强安全设置:为了保证网站的安全,可以采取以下措施:开启HTTPS加密传输、设置防火墙规则、定期更新软件和系统补丁、限制IP访问等,建议使用SSL证书对网站进行加密保护。,您可以使用云服务器来部署网站。以下是一些步骤:,,1. 选择一个云服务器提供商,例如腾讯云、阿里云等。,2. 注册并登录您的账户。,3. 购买一个云服务器实例。,4. 在云服务器上安装Web服务器软件,例如Apache、Nginx等。,5. 将您的网站文件上传到云服务器上的Web服务器软件中。,6. 配置Web服务器以便它可以处理来自互联网的请求并返回您的网站内容。

版权声明:本文采用知识共享 署名4.0国际许可协议 [BY-NC-SA] 进行授权
文章名称:《云服务器上怎么部署网站》
文章链接:https://zhuji.vsping.com/317284.html
本站资源仅供个人学习交流,请于下载后24小时内删除,不允许用于商业用途,否则法律问题自行承担。